Transaction 5684301e3a17fc786913aa69b35f5e25c9fb95985e4a3b20ce5cc988d395764f
1 Input
1 Output
-
5684301e3a17fc786913aa69b35f5e25c9fb95985e4a3b20ce5cc988d395764f:0
- value
- 129323
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8159ad45482506f6bf6259eced702542051d3d2f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CnwbbvS9t822TKjD8nJXig4NbkTav6ruw